引言

随着区块链技术的发展,越来越多的人开始关注加密货币和去中心化应用(dApps)。MetaMask作为一种流行的以太坊钱包,不仅允许用户存储和管理他们的加密资产,还能与各种去中心化应用进行交互。虽然MetaMask最初是为Chrome浏览器设计的,但在Firefox中安装MetaMask同样简单。本文将为你详细介绍如何在Firefox中安装和使用MetaMask。

MetaMask简介

MetaMask是一个以太坊钱包和浏览器扩展,它使用户能够便利地访问去中心化应用和管理以太币(ETH)及其他ERC20代币。在使用传统的区块链服务时,用户往往会面临复杂的操作和繁琐的过程,而MetaMask则通过一个友好的用户界面,让这一切变得简单明了。通过MetaMask,用户能够生成私钥、管理账户、发送和接收加密货币,甚至与智能合约进行交互。

在Firefox中安装MetaMask的步骤

在Firefox浏览器中安装MetaMask非常简单,以下是详细的步骤:

  • 第一步:打开Firefox浏览器

    确保你使用的是最新版本的Firefox浏览器,以确保兼容性和安全性。

  • 第二步:访问MetaMask官方网站

    在浏览器中输入https://metamask.io并按Enter。确保从官方网站下载MetaMask。

  • 第三步:下载MetaMask扩展

    在MetaMask页面上,点击“下载”按钮,接着选择“Firefox”选项。该网站会引导你前往Firefox的附加功能页面。

  • 第四步:安装扩展

    在Firefox附加功能页面上,点击“添加到Firefox”,然后确认安装权限并继续安装。

  • 第五步:设置MetaMask

    安装完成后,点击Firefox右上角的MetaMask图标。你可以选择“创建钱包”或“导入钱包”。如果你是新用户,可以选择创建新钱包。

一旦你完成设置,你就可以开始使用MetaMask,并连接到各种dApps,进行加密货币交易。

如何使用MetaMask进行交易

在成功安装和设置MetaMask后,你可以使用它进行交易。以下是使用MetaMask进行交易的基本步骤:

  • 第一步:添加资金

    点击MetaMask图标,登录你的钱包。选择“购买”或“接收”,你可以通过不同的方式添加数字资产,这包括银行转账、信用卡支付等。

  • 第二步:选择交易和网络

    在MetaMask中,用户可以选择不同的网络(如以太坊主网、测试网等)。在交易前,确保你选择了正确的网络。

  • 第三步:发起交易

    选择“发送”选项,输入接收方的钱包地址及发送金额,确认无误后,点击“下一步”进行交易确认。

MetaMask会显示交易费,用户可以选择不同的费用选项(如慢、快速)。确认后,交易会被提交到区块链上,并等待确认。使用MetaMask的一个优点是,它会自动为你计算交易费用,确保你有足够的ETH支付手续费。

MetaMask的安全性

使用MetaMask进行交易时,安全性是用户通常会关注的一个重要议题。以下是关于MetaMask安全性的一些基本信息:

  • 私钥管理

    MetaMask使用私钥进行加密保护。用户的私钥存储在本地,只有用户可以访问。MetaMask永远不会将用户的私钥存储在服务器上,确保用户的资产安全。

  • 密码保护

    在安装MetaMask时,用户要设置一个密码。这个密码将用于每次打开钱包时进行身份验证。强密码能有效提升安全性。

  • 确保更新

    保持MetaMask及Firefox的更新至关重要。每次发行新版本时,通常都会包含安全修复和新特性。

遵循这些安全性措施,可以大大降低用户在使用MetaMask时遇到风险的可能性。

常见问题解答

在使用MetaMask过程中,用户可能会遇到一些常见问题。以下是一些可能需要解答的

MetaMask如何与dApps互通?

MetaMask不仅是一个加密钱包,它还充当着用户与区块链应用之间的桥梁。当你在去中心化交易所(如Uniswap或SushiSwap)上进行交易时,这些应用需要与以太坊网络交互,而MetaMask会帮助你在不论是选择交易还是浏览时轻松地进行这一过程。通过连接你的MetaMask钱包,你可以在dApps上自由进行操作,所有的智能合约调用都会直接通过MetaMask执行。当你确认一项交易时,MetaMask会提示你所有相关信息,包括交易的费用。确保你了解这些信息,以便作出明智的决策。此外,你还可以通过MetaMask直接访问多个以太坊网络,如主网和测试网,这使得开发者在测试新dApp时特别有用。

MetaMask支持哪些网络?

MetaMask不仅支持以太坊主网络,还支持多个测试网络,如Ropsten、Rinkeby、Kovan等。此外,MetaMask还在逐步实现对其他以太坊兼容网络(如Binance Smart Chain、Polygon、Fantom等)的支持。用户可以根据不同的需求选择切换到相应的网络。切换网络的方法也非常简单,只需在MetaMask界面上选择相应的网络即可。对于开发者来说,测试网络提供了一个无风险的环境来进行开发和测试,用户可以在这里模拟真实的交易,而不会影响到主网中的资产。

我可以在不同的浏览器上使用同一个MetaMask钱包吗?

是的,你完全可以在不同的浏览器上使用同一个MetaMask钱包。MetaMask允许用户通过“导入钱包”功能,将同一钱包的助记词(或私钥)导入到另一个浏览器的MetaMask扩展中。这意味着如果你在Chrome中创建了一个MetaMask钱包,你只需在Firefox或其他浏览器中输入同样的助记词,就能访问相同的资产和设置。不过,值得注意的是,如果你在不同的扩展或设备上使用相同的钱包,请确保妥善保管你的助记词和私钥,以避免丢失资产的风险。

MetaMask如何帮助用户进行代币交换?

MetaMask本身有内置的交换功能,使得用户可以将一种代币转换为另一种代币。用户只需选择“交换”选项,输入要兑换的代币数量,根据当前市场汇率,MetaMask会自动为用户计算出相应的代币数量。在确认交易前,用户可以看到所有相关的费用信息,包括网络费和交易费。这给了用户一个快速而又方便的方式来管理他们的资产,而无需访问第三方交易所,从而提高了用户体验。

使用MetaMask进行交易时,如何避免交易失败?

交易失败通常是由几个主要原因引起的。首先,确保你选择的Gas费是合理的。Gas费过低可能导致交易在网络繁忙时长时间无法确认。MetaMask提供了快速、中等和慢速的Gas费选项,用户可以根据网络状态选择相应的费用。其次,确认你使用的地址格式是否正确,地址错误会导致交易失败,甚至资产损失。此外,确保你管理的资产在进行交易之前已经足够,包括在Gas费用和交易金额中。如果你遵循这些基本的操作建议,就会大大降低交易失败的风险。

结论

在Firefox中使用MetaMask可以显著提高你在区块链上的体验,既方便又安全。无论是进行简单的加密交易,还是深入参与到去中心化应用的世界,MetaMask都为用户提供了强大的工具和支持。本文旨在帮助你了解如何在Firefox浏览器中安装和使用MetaMask的同时,回答一些常见问题,以便使你能够更好地利用这一强大的工具。随着区块链领域的不断发展,MetaMask和其他相关技术将会变得愈加重要,而你所掌握的这些知识也将为你在这个全新而有趣的领域的冒险打下一个良好的基础。